The Wall Street Journal reported that researchers at Harvard Medical School have found that one-third of American workers are not getting enough sleep, and as a result, companies are losing billions of dollars. Companies such as Procter & Gamble and Goldman Sachs Group are investing in programs aimed at helping their employees improve their sleep.  A few months ago I posted a blog entry about how people are dangerously overusing caffeinated energy drinks to attempt to remedy their lethargy.
